The following daily average vertical column abundances were retrieved from solar absorption spectra measured by the Bruker Interferometer, a FTIR spectrometer, in Bremen. The retrieval of the column abundances was performed by the GFIT algorithm, which used temperature profiles from sondes launched daily in Ny-Aalesund, and an initial set of vmr profiles derived from MkIV balloon measurements (G. Toon, JPL), which were then stretched/compressed to account for day-to-day variations in the tropopause altitude and subsidence. The errors tabulated in the main part of the data file, determined from the quality of the spectral fits, represent the 1-sigma measurement precisions. These errors are appropriate for comparing columns measured on different days. For most gases, the main systematic errors arise from uncertainties in the assumed vmr profiles shapes, and from uncertainties in the spectroscopic parameters (of both the target gas and interfering gases). Note that "day" and "hour" are completely redundant since day = 365.25*(year-int(year)) ; hour = 24.000*(day-int(day)) They are nevertheless included for the convenience of the user. Note that hour is allowed to exceed 24.0 in order to avoid introducing an apparent time discontinuity between observations made at 3:59 pm local time and 4:01 pm local time on the same day (Pacific Time is 8 hours behind UT). The true UT hour can be obtained simply by amod(hour,24.).
